In "The Pot-Boiler," Edith Wharton deftly critiques the commercialism of the American literary marketplace during the early 20th century. This satirical novella employs a sharp and witty narrative style, utilizing a blend of humor and irony to expose the motives behind popular fiction. Wharton constructs a vivid tableau of the artistic struggle, juxtaposing the integrity of true artistry against the allure of financial gain. Set against the backdrop of a society increasingly obsessed with fame and success, the work explores themes of authenticity and the commodification of creativity, illustrating the tension between a writer's ambition and the demands of the market. Wharton, an esteemed author known for her acute social observation, was a pioneer in portraying the complexities of upper-class American society. Her own experiences in the literary world and her discontent with the superficiality of commercial literature undoubtedly influenced her to pen "The Pot-Boiler." Raised in a privileged environment and educated in the intricacies of taste and culture, Wharton's critique emerges from her intimate understanding of both artistic aspiration and societal expectation.
